Top Health and beauty shops in Id 83301 United States

Usa-Places.com has listed approx 4 Health and beauty shops in ID 83301. Some of the Top rated Health and beauty shops in ID 83301 are- Beauty Box, Plant Therapy, Epic-Dermis Skin & Body & Hot Deals eStore.

Place Name
Type
Address
Health and beauty shop
Health and beauty shop
735 Shoshone St E, Twin Falls, ID 83301, United States
Health and beauty shop
1485 Pole Line Rd E Suite 257, Twin Falls, ID 83301, United States
Health and beauty shop
inside 260 Aesthetics, 260 Falls Ave Suite D, Twin Falls, ID 83301, United States
Health and beauty shop
176 Maurice St N #314, Twin Falls, ID 83301, United States

Similar Categories